Just wanted to share a couple of layouts that are up on the Jillibean Soup blog today.  The first is a look back at some of the things in history that I will remember most about the 2000’s.  I found all of these photos by googling the event + “creative commons”.  The design is based on a sketch by Donna Januzzi from the Ella Publishing Co. ebook, Double-Page Design: Creating two-page layouts that really shine.  I spritzed the white canvas flowers with glimmer mists to match the papers.

The next one is about a 5K run that our family did in support of my husband’s lab where they do atrial fibrillation cardiac research.  The run was to raise funding for research and awareness.  We had a blast.  The design is based on a CK sketch.  I stitched one running bib down, punched circles in the other to make embellishments, and stitched on the name codes as well.  I cut out a large 5 from white card stock and ran it through my paper crimper so it would match the corrugated alphas.
